Key Responsibilities
- Post incoming payments to customer accounts
- Scan and reconcile daily deposits to the bank
- Perform client and bank reconciliation
- Prepare, verify, and record transactions related to accounts receivable
- Validate payment batches for accuracy
- Research and resolve discrepancies in customer/client payments
- Collaborate with client service teams to ensure accounts receivable accuracy
- File and retrieve A/R documentation as needed
- Update internal records with client/payment information
- Support additional clerical functions as assigned
